Cipalla Named to a Pair of All-Region Squads

The Spartan senior was the D3hoops Region 5 Player of the Year

YORK, PA – York College senior forward Kai Cipalla has earned a pair of all-region awards on Tuesday by two national organizations. He was named the D3hoops.com Region 5 Player of the Year in addition to being a member of the first team. Cipalla also earned NABC first-team All-Region 5 honors.
 
Cipalla is the second Spartan to earn the D3hoops.com regional Player of the Year joining Chad McGowan who earned the honor after the 2006-07 season.
 
Cipalla is now a two-time All-Region 5 first-team honoree as he was recognized as an all-region player last year. Cipalla is now the fourth Spartan to earn multiple all-region honors. He joins Brandon Bushey (2003-04, 2004-05, and 2005-06), McGowan (2005-06, 2006-07, and 2007-08) and Andy O'Brien (2001-02 and 2002-03) as Spartans to earn the honor multiple times.
 
Cipalla finished the year averaging 20.2 points and 6.7 rebounds per game as he played a team-high 34.8 minutes per game. Cipalla shot 57% from the floor, 30% from three and 67.2% from the free throw line.
 
He was named the MAC Commonwealth Player of the Year as he earned MAC All-Commonwealth honors for the third time in his Spartan career. He led the MAC Commonwealth in scoring and field goal percentage. His 221 made field goals were 58 more than the next player in the Commonwealth. Cipalla was second in the league in free throws made at 123, seven back of the top spot. He ranked sixth in total rebounds including third in offensive rebounds with 74.
 
Cipalla finished his career with 1,444 points, 529 rebounds, 146 assists, 83 steals and 74 blocked shots. He was a career 57.9% shooter from the floor with 557 field goals. Cipalla was 279-for-404 (69.4%) from the free throw line. He played 2,629 minutes in his 80 career games. His 18.1 points per game average ranks fourth on the all-time Spartan list.
 
Cipalla will wear the Spartan Green and White one more time Saturday when the plays in the NABC Senior All-Star Game in Fort Wayne, Indiana.
